NiDCOM Seeks Justice For Nigerian Murdered In Ireland

Follow us on Social Media

Social sharing

The Chairman /CEO, Nigerians in Diaspora Commission (NIDCOM), Honourable Abike Dabiri-Erewa, has condemned in strong terms
the killing of Mr George Nkencho, a 27-year-old Nigerian in Ireland.

A statement made available to 9News Nigeria in Abuja on Thursday by NIDCOM Head of Media and Public Relations, Abdur-Rahman Balogun, described the death of a young Nigerian by a Police officer
as callous and wicked.

According to Balogun, Dabiri-Erewa who was apparently disturbed by the killing has demanded for a full, thorough and fair investigation into the matter.

She appealed to the obviously enraged Nigerian community in Ireland to
exercise patience and await the outcome of investigation into the
unfortunate incident.

The NIDCOM boss however condoled with the family of Nkencho and the Nigerian community in Ireland over the killing of George and prayed God to give the family and friends the fortitude to bear the irreplaceable loss.

Already, the African Advocacy Network Ireland (AANI) has expressed shock
to learn about the callous shooting dead of George Nkencho on Wednesday,
December 30.

The group said the circumstances surrounding the killing of a mentally-challenged young man has enraged the African community and has demanded a full independent public inquiry.
